#275806 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#275806 is composed of 15.3% red, 34.5%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 95.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 18.4%. #275806 color hex could be obtained by blending #4eb00c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#275806 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#275806 has RGB values of R:39, G:88,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 2578438.

Shades and Tints of #275806
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ffb is the lightest one.
